A CPA's task entails functioning to guarantee that entities and also people are keeping good records as well as paying the correct taxes promptly.
A CPA can have a "public" job description. This kind of work can be summed up in what the majority of people visualize as regular accounting professional's job. It includes executing a wide range of audit, bookkeeping, tax, as well as seeking advice from activities for their customers, which may be companies, federal governments, nonprofit companies, and individuals. CPA specialties are frequently picked.
For instance, a Certified Public Accountant might choose to focus on tax issues, such as suggesting companies concerning the tax benefits and also disadvantages of particular organization decisions and preparing private income tax returns. Various other Certified public accountants might pick locations such as settlement, staff member healthcare benefits, or layout of bookkeeping as well as information processing systems.
“Supervisory" Certified public accountants works in a company. These Certified public accountants are also called an expense, monitoring, industrial, company, or exclusive accountants. Certified Public Accountant supervisory accounting professionals record as well as evaluate the financial info of the firms for which they work. This task description includes an in-depth listing of duties - such as budgeting, performance examination, cost administration, and also asset monitoring.
An "interior auditor" CPA can primarily be summed up by the job title. Interior auditors verify the precision of their company's interior records. They check for mismanagement, waste, or scams. This is a significantly essential area of audit. Interior auditors analyze and also review their firms' monetary and info systems, monitoring treatments, and internal controls to make certain that records are accurate and controls are adequate.

CPAs are college-educated as well as licensed experts certified by the states in which they practice. They have passed an extensive licensing examination and also are called for to comply with rigorous values standards. They are to remain present with evolving tax obligation regulations and guidelines. Just Certified public accountants, attorneys, or enrolled agents are authorized to represent you before the IRS.
